If you call qmake of the prebuilt binaries of Qt, it produces XCode project files (xxx.xcodeproj) instead of make files. You can create regular make files with this commands:

If you want to create make files per default, you can tell qmake by executing the following commands

$QTDIR is the directory of your Qt installation (e.g. /usr/local/Trolltech/Qt-4.7.0).
